Linux पर लोड औसत अधिक क्यों है?
यदि आप सिंगल-सीपीयू सिस्टम पर 20 थ्रेड्स स्पॉन करते हैं, तो आपको एक उच्च लोड औसत दिखाई दे सकता है, भले ही ऐसी कोई विशेष प्रक्रिया न हो जो सीपीयू समय को बाँधती हो। उच्च लोड का अगला कारण एक सिस्टम है जो उपलब्ध RAM से बाहर हो गया है और स्वैप में जाना शुरू कर दिया है।
Linux उच्च लोड औसत क्या है?
अंत में, यदि आप एक सिस्टम एडमिनिस्ट्रेटर हैं तो उच्च लोड औसत चिंता का विषय है। जब वे उच्च होते हैं, CPU कोर की संख्या से अधिक, यह CPU की उच्च मांग को दर्शाता है , और CPU कोर की संख्या से कम लोड औसत हमें बताता है कि CPU का कम उपयोग किया गया है। लिनक्स मॉनिटरिंग, लिनक्स सर्वर मॉनिटरिंग।
हाई लोड एवरेज का क्या मतलब है?
1 से अधिक लोड औसत 1 कोर/थ्रेड को संदर्भित करता है . तो अंगूठे का एक नियम यह है कि आपके कोर/धागे के बराबर औसत भार ठीक है, अधिक संभावना है कि कतारबद्ध प्रक्रियाएं और चीजें धीमी हो जाएंगी।
लिनक्स लोड औसत का क्या मतलब है?
लोड औसत एक निर्धारित अवधि के लिए Linux सर्वर पर औसत सिस्टम लोड . है . दूसरे शब्दों में, यह एक सर्वर की सीपीयू मांग है जिसमें रनिंग और वेटिंग थ्रेड्स का योग शामिल होता है। ... ये संख्याएं एक, पांच और 15 मिनट की अवधि में सिस्टम लोड का औसत हैं।
Linux में औसत लोड का समस्या निवारण कैसे करें?
लिनक्स पर लोड औसत जांचने के हमारे पास 4 तरीके हैं।
- बिल्ली /proc/loadavg.
- अपटाइम.
- w.
- शीर्ष।
एक अच्छा लोड औसत क्या है?
अंगूठे का सामान्य नियम यह है कि लोड औसत मशीन में प्रोसेसर की संख्या से अधिक नहीं होना चाहिए। यदि प्रोसेसर की संख्या चार है, तो लोड आमतौर पर 4.0 से कम रहना चाहिए ।
Linux में लोड की गणना कैसे की जाती है?
Linux पर, लोड औसत "सिस्टम लोड औसत" होते हैं (या होने की कोशिश करते हैं), पूरे सिस्टम के लिए, काम करने वाले और काम करने के लिए प्रतीक्षा कर रहे थ्रेड्स की संख्या को मापना (सीपीयू, डिस्क, अबाधित ताले)। दूसरे शब्दों में कहें तो यह उन धागों की संख्या को मापता है जो पूरी तरह से निष्क्रिय नहीं हैं।
क्या CPU उपयोग 100 से अधिक हो सकता है?
%CPU — CPU उपयोग:आपके CPU का प्रतिशत जो प्रक्रिया द्वारा उपयोग किया जा रहा है। डिफ़ॉल्ट रूप से, शीर्ष इसे एकल CPU के प्रतिशत के रूप में प्रदर्शित करता है। मल्टी-कोर सिस्टम पर, आपके पास ऐसे प्रतिशत हो सकते हैं जो 100% से अधिक हों . उदाहरण के लिए, यदि 3 कोर 60% उपयोग में हैं, तो शीर्ष 180% का सीपीयू उपयोग दिखाएगा।
हाई लोड क्या है?
जब एक भौतिक सर्वर में कोई क्षमता नहीं होती है या डेटा को प्रभावी ढंग से संसाधित नहीं कर सकता है, यह तब होता है जब एक उच्च भार का अनुभव होता है। यह एक उच्च भार है जब एक सर्वर एक साथ 10,000 कनेक्शन प्रदान करता है . Highload हजारों या लाखों उपयोगकर्ताओं को सेवाएं प्रदान कर रहा है।
Linux में Iowait क्या है?
iowait बस निष्क्रिय समय का एक रूप है जब कुछ भी निर्धारित नहीं किया जा सकता है . मान एक प्रदर्शन समस्या को इंगित करने में उपयोगी हो सकता है या नहीं भी हो सकता है, लेकिन यह उपयोगकर्ता को बताता है कि सिस्टम निष्क्रिय है और अधिक काम कर सकता था। टिप्पणियाँ:एक सीपीयू चार राज्यों में से एक में हो सकता है:उपयोगकर्ता, sys, निष्क्रिय, या iowait।
लिनक्स में PS EF कमांड क्या है?
इस कमांड का उपयोग प्रक्रिया की PID (प्रोसेस आईडी, प्रक्रिया की विशिष्ट संख्या) को खोजने के लिए किया जाता है . प्रत्येक प्रक्रिया में एक विशिष्ट संख्या होगी जिसे प्रक्रिया का पीआईडी कहा जाता है।
लिनक्स में फ्री कमांड क्या करता है?
फ्री कमांड प्रयुक्त और अप्रयुक्त मेमोरी उपयोग और सिस्टम की स्वैप मेमोरी के बारे में जानकारी देता है . डिफ़ॉल्ट रूप से, यह kb (किलोबाइट) में मेमोरी प्रदर्शित करता है। मेमोरी में मुख्य रूप से RAM (रैंडम एक्सेस मेमोरी) और स्वैप मेमोरी होती है।
लोड औसत और CPU उपयोग में क्या अंतर है?
मूल रूप से, लोड औसत पिछले 1, 5, और 15 मिनट में आपके CPU(s) पर ट्रैफ़िक की मात्रा है . आम तौर पर आप चाहते हैं कि यह संख्या आपके पास मौजूद CPU(s)/cores की संख्या से कम हो। सिंगल कोर मशीन पर 1.0 का मतलब है कि यह सीपीयू का अधिकतम उपयोग कर रहा है, और इससे ऊपर की किसी भी चीज का मतलब है कि चीजें कतारबद्ध हो रही हैं।
लिनक्स में निष्क्रिय प्रक्रिया कहां है?
ज़ोंबी प्रक्रिया को कैसे पहचानें। ज़ोंबी प्रक्रियाओं को ps कमांड . के साथ आसानी से पाया जा सकता है . पीएस आउटपुट के भीतर एक एसटीएटी कॉलम होता है जो प्रक्रियाओं को वर्तमान स्थिति दिखाएगा, एक ज़ोंबी प्रक्रिया में जेड स्थिति होगी। STAT कॉलम के अलावा, ज़ोम्बी में आमतौर पर CMD कॉलम में